NXT General Manager William Regal has announced that some NXT champions have been forced to vacate their titles.
Regal took to Twitter to announce that Oney Lorcan and Danny Burch will vacate the NXT Tag Team Championship. Stating that he’ll explain more on this week’s NXT, Regal tweeted:
“I can confirm this incredibly unfortunate news and make the difficult decision to vacate the #WWENXT Tag Team Titles. Furthermore, I will address the state of the titles further tomorrow night on @WWENXT“
Danny Burch was injured on NXT last week during a tag team match against Finn Balor and Karrion Kross. Oney Lorcan had to finish the match by himself, before Burch was evaluated. It was later confirmed that Burch had suffered a shoulder separation.
Burch and Lorcan won the NXT Tag Team Championship in October last year. They had previously defended the title against Breezango, and Killian Dain and Drake Maverick.
It is currently unknown how the next NXT Tag Team Champions will be decided. With NXT TakeOver: Stand & Deliver only 2 weeks away, it is possible a match for the vacant titles will be made official on NXT tomorrow night.
